Lenz's law demonstration, 2 of 2. Lenz's law is demonstrated using two metal hoops (one open and one closed) that are balanced by and can freely rotate around a centrally mounted pin. Lenz's law states that the current induced in a closed loop due to the change in the magnetic flux through the loop is directed to oppose the change in flux, thus exerting a mechanical force which opposes the motion. Photo 1: when the magnet is moved away from the closed hoop, the flux through the hoop decreases. As a result, the hoop moves towards the magnet. Photo 2: when the same experiment is repeated with the open hoop, the hoop does not move as induced circular current can not flow. | |
